What compensation can be claimed in a personal injury case?

Ask a Human Rights Law lawyer in Brassall

Victims can claim comp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and loss of enjoyment of life.;In some cases, victims may also be eligible for future care costs and rehabilitation expenses.

How are security deposits handled in Australia?

Ask a Human Rights Law lawyer in Brassall

Security deposits must be lodged with the relevant state or territory authority.;Landlords must return the deposit within a specified period after the lease ends, minus any legitimate deductions.
